How To Secure Investment Property Loans In The UK

Investing in property can be a lucrative endeavor, especially in the UK where real estate prices continue to rise However, many investors may not have the capital on hand to purchase properties outright In such cases, investment property loans in the UK can be a valuable tool to help investors acquire the properties they desire.

Investment property loans in the UK are designed specifically for the purpose of purchasing real estate with the intention of generating rental income or capital appreciation These loans are different from traditional residential mortgages, as they are specifically tailored to meet the needs of property investors.

When considering applying for an investment property loan in the UK, there are several factors to keep in mind Here are some key points to consider when looking for financing:

1 Loan Options: There are various loan options available to property investors in the UK Some of the most common types of investment property loans include buy-to-let mortgages, commercial mortgages, and bridging loans Each type of loan has its own set of terms and conditions, so it’s important to carefully consider which option is best suited to your investment goals.

2 Eligibility Criteria: Lenders will have specific eligibility criteria that borrowers must meet in order to qualify for an investment property loan These criteria may include factors such as credit score, income level, and the value of the property being purchased It’s important to review these requirements before applying for a loan to ensure that you meet the necessary qualifications.

4 Loan to Value Ratio: The loan to value (LTV) ratio is an important factor to consider when applying for an investment property loan This ratio represents the percentage of the property’s value that the lender is willing to finance In general, the lower the LTV ratio, the lower the risk for the lender, which may result in more favorable loan terms for the borrower.

5 Repayment Terms: When taking out an investment property loan in the UK, it’s important to carefully review the repayment terms Consider factors such as the length of the loan, the frequency of payments, and any penalties for early repayment Understanding these terms will help you to budget effectively and avoid any potential financial pitfalls.
